Reimagining Social Media: Bond’s AI-Driven Escape from Screen Addiction
As legacy social media platforms draw users into a cycle of endless scrolling, often filled with mindless memes and videos, many companies are now looking to break this cycle. Users have begun to express fatigue from the digital world, and startups are stepping in to offer alternatives that promote real-world experiences rather than screen time. One such company is Bond, which made its official launch recently.
A New Approach to Social Media
Bond’s co-founder and CEO, Dino Becirovic, believes the platform provides an innovative, AI-powered solution to the rising issue of screen addiction among Americans. Unlike conventional social media sites designed mainly for advertising engagement, Bond’s core mission is to encourage users to live life beyond their screens.
Subscribers can share updates similar to those found on other social media sites, but Bond introduces a focus on “memories.” Users can upload various forms of content, including pictures, videos, and audio clips, allowing for rich and diverse storytelling.
Real-World Experiences Through AI
What makes Bond unique is its focus on real-life engagement. The platform leverages the data created from user “memories” to generate personalized recommendations. For example, if a user frequently shares their love for pho, the system might suggest nearby Vietnamese restaurants with favorable reviews. Similarly, fans of heavy metal could be alerted about upcoming concerts featuring their favorite bands.
Becirovic emphasizes that the more users engage and share their experiences, the better the AI can tailor suggestions, ultimately encouraging them to explore their environment and enjoy activities outside their homes.
Breaking the Cycle of Doomscrolling
Bond’s design aims to break away from the habits of “bed rotting” and “doomscrolling,” terms that have become common among younger audiences. Instead of trapping users in a perpetual news feed, the platform adopts a layout reminiscent of Instagram but without an endless scroll. Profiles are arranged in clusters, and tapping on a profile reveals current stories that vanish after 24 hours but are stored privately for future reference. This structure encourages users to actively participate in their lives while still maintaining a digital presence.
A Seasoned Team Behind Bond
Bond is backed by a knowledgeable team with experience in building major social media platforms like TikTok, Twitter, and Facebook. Becirovic himself has a rich background in venture capital, having worked with firms like Kleiner Perkins and Index Ventures. The founding researcher, Arthur Bražinskas, was instrumental in integrating user signals at Google Gemini, further affirming the expertise behind Bond’s development.
Revenue Model: A New Financial Path
One of the significant challenges that any new social media platform faces is monetization. Traditional models rely heavily on advertising, creating revenue streams that can compromise user experience. Bond, however, plans to take a different route.
Becirovic envisions a future where users can license their data archived within Bond. This model would allow users to sell their digital memories to companies interested in using them for AI training, with Bond taking a small percentage of the profits as a licensing fee. By becoming a data provider, Bond aims to generate revenue while maintaining user-centered values.
Potential E-Commerce Integration
In addition to licensing, Bond sees opportunities for enhancing user experience through product recommendations. By integrating with e-commerce platforms, Bond can enable personalized shopping experiences driven by users’ memories and preferences. Users would opt into this feature voluntarily, allowing Bond to capture additional revenue through transactions while enhancing user satisfaction.
Becirovic stresses that Bond will never sell user data for advertising purposes, a relief for users wary of traditional social media practices. Users will retain control over their memories, allowing them to easily delete content as necessary. Bond aims to introduce robust privacy features as it evolves, ensuring users can manage their data effectively.
Commitment to Data Privacy and Security
Data protection is a pivotal aspect of any online platform, and Bond is committed to enhancing its security measures over time. While the application seeks to implement end-to-end encryption (E2EE) soon after launch, Becirovic assures users that their information is already stored securely.
For users concerned about their privacy, the platform will offer simple mechanisms for managing memories and even deleting entire profiles if they feel Bond isn’t meeting their needs. This user-first approach fosters trust, setting Bond apart in a crowded market of social media alternatives.
